The bill, H. 4376, is a House Resolution expressing support for the Williams Transco Southeast Supply Enhancement Project. The resolution highlights the importance of this project in sustaining economic growth and ensuring a consistent energy supply for South Carolina, particularly in light of the significant increase in natural gas consumption over the past decade. The project is designed to enhance access to natural gas, thereby expanding energy capacity to meet the rising demand while also creating job opportunities for residents of the state.
Additionally, the resolution emphasizes the project's commitment to maintaining high safety standards and environmental responsibility, ensuring compliance with regulations that protect local communities and ecosystems. By adopting this resolution, the members of the South Carolina House of Representatives formally express their backing for the Williams Transco Southeast Supply Enhancement Project, recognizing its potential benefits for the state's energy infrastructure and economic development.
